Steps to Take Following an Accident Near You in East Windsor

The moments following a personal injury can be overwhelming. But your actions — or inactions — in the early stages can affect your case outcome. Regardless of where the injury took place, these actions can protect your rights:
Seek Immediate Medical Attention

Your health should be the priority. Even if symptoms seem minor, get checked. Delayed injuries (like concussions or internal bleeding) can worsen quickly.

Document Everything

Take photos of the injury, the location where it happened, any equipment or hazards involved, and keep track of your symptoms. This evidence can prove vital later.

Get Witness Information

If anyone saw the incident, collect their contact information. Their statements can back up your version of events.

File a Report if Applicable

For car crashes, workplace injuries, or slip and falls on commercial properties, always report the incident to the proper authority or manager and obtain a copy of the report.

Avoid Talking to Insurance Adjusters Alone

They may act friendly, but their job is to protect their company’s bottom line. Don’t provide statements until you speak with a personal injury lawyer.

Contact a Trusted East Windsor Personal Injury Attorney

Legal guidance from the start can prevent critical mistakes and increase your chances of recovering full compensation.

Showing Negligence in East Windsor Personal Injury Matters

At the core of personal injury lawsuits is the legal concept of negligence — the neglect in expected behavior that brings about harm to another person. In order to prove fault, our attorneys must demonstrate these core components:
Duty of Care

The defendant had a legal obligation to act in a reasonably safe manner. For example, a property owner must keep their premises hazard-free, and a driver must obey traffic laws.

Breach of Duty

We must prove that the defendant failed to meet their duty. This could involve reckless driving, a wet floor without signage, or a defective product released to the public.

Causation

It’s not enough to show that the defendant was careless — we must also prove that this breach directly caused your injuries. This step often involves expert testimony and detailed accident reconstruction.

Damages

Lastly, we must show that you suffered actual harm — physical, emotional, or financial — as a result of the negligence.

In New Jersey, the doctrine of shared fault could affect your case. This means if you had any responsibility, your award will be adjusted by your proportion of responsibility. For example, if a court finds you 20% negligent, your total compensation is lowered by that portion.

Key Evidence That Supports Your East Windsor Personal Injury Claim

To win a personal injury case in East Windsor requires more than just your word — it’s about supporting it with legal-quality documentation. At Boyadzhyan Law Firm, we thoroughly investigate every angle when securing the evidence, records, and witness statements needed to win your case.

Here are some of the most impactful types of evidence we build into every case:

Medical Records and Treatment Documentation

Your medical history post-injury is crucial for establishing the severity and long-term impact of your injuries. We gather emergency room visits, diagnostics, physical therapy reports, and future treatment plans from licensed providers.

Photos and Videos from the Scene

Visual proof helps show what written reports often cannot. We collect images of the injury scene, damages, visible injuries, and environmental conditions like poor lighting, wet floors, or missing signage.

Eyewitness Testimony

Statements from bystanders, co-workers, or family members can help corroborate your account and highlight the immediate aftermath of the accident.

Expert Testimony

We work with medical experts, vocational rehabilitation specialists, and accident reconstructionists to validate how the injury occurred and how it impacts your life physically, emotionally, and financially.

Employment and Income Records

These records support wage loss claims, including missed workdays, future loss of earning potential, and benefits lost due to long-term disability.
